Description
It is unbelievable the number of cars that blow through the stop sign here and the next block. With so many neighbirhood pedestrians, this is so unsafe. Traffic has greatly increased since Flagstaff car wash became operating in the area. Is there a way to have them exit toward Broad Street? Or can we put flashing stop signs or speed bump?

- Staff · July 14, 2026Sauer Ave between Broad St and Monument Ave stops at Broad St, Augusta Ave, Cutshaw Ave, W. Grace St and Monument Ave. The average speed on Sauer Ave between Broad St and Monument Ave ranged between 13mph – 16mph in a 25mph zone. Traffic calming measures such as speed tables are not currently planned. Flashing lights is a capital improvement and not in the Adopted 2027 Budget for Richmond. Contact the Richmond Police Department (804.646.5100) to report motorists running stop signs.
